
Irregular verbs in English, beginning with the letter w. Learn the verbs in their past simple form in column one. See the verbs used in context in column two.
|
I woke up early yesterday morning. (wake - woke - woken)
|
|
I wore a Santa Claus hat last Christmas. (wear - wore - worn)
|
|
He wept all the way through the film last week. (weep - wept - wept)
|
|
I won every race last Sport's Day. (win - won - won)
|
|
The teacher wrote his reports last month. (write - wrote - written)
